Feng Ruohang fd2ca1c6d2 docs: rebrand the repository documentation, templates and dashboards
README, README_ZH, SECURITY, COMPLIANCE, CONTRIBUTING, NOTICE,
code_of_conduct, the vulnerability and PR-etiquette documents, the GitHub issue
and pull request templates, and the docs/ tree all present Silo as the product.
The Grafana dashboards under docs/metrics/prometheus/grafana/ have their panel
titles and descriptions rebranded while every minio_* query, label and
expression is left alone, so existing alerts and recording rules keep matching.

The distinction the review demanded is applied per hit rather than by
search-and-replace:

- Product and command text becomes Silo and silo: install and run instructions,
  systemd examples, compose services, download links, badges.
- Protocol and interface text keeps MinIO: MINIO_* variables, minio_* metrics,
  x-minio-* headers, /minio/* routes, .minio.sys, arn:minio, and API field and
  error names.
- Attribution keeps MinIO and gains the fork's own: the AGPL obligations,
  original copyright, CREDITS and NOTICE stay, with the modification notice
  added alongside rather than replacing them.
- Historical and third-party references are left as facts, not rewritten for
  brand tidiness.

README and README_ZH each carry an explicit non-affiliation notice, document
the side-by-side package migration including the
/etc/systemd/system/silo.service.d/10-legacy-user.conf drop-in for keeping a
legacy UID/GID, and state that recursive chown is never performed. The trademark
attribution uses the policy's approved "based on MinIO technology" wording, not
the shortened form the policy rejects.

github.com/pgsty/minio links are left in place and labelled transitional. The
repository has not been renamed, and rewriting them now would produce documented
URLs that 404 until the cutover; they change in the cutover commit together with
the goreleaser release target, the OCI source label and the raw-content branch.
